Optimizing System Performance in Logistics Operations

Efficient logistics operations depend on high-performing technology systems. Transportation management platforms, inventory tracking tools, and warehouse automation systems all rely on consistent performance to ensure goods move seamlessly from origin to destination. System performance monitoring plays a crucial role in maintaining operational reliability, preventing costly downtime, and supporting business growth.

Our methodology involves real-time monitoring of software, network, and hardware components to detect performance degradation before it impacts operations. Metrics such as system uptime, response times, transaction volumes, and error rates are tracked continuously, allowing our team to proactively address bottlenecks and failures.

For logistics providers, even minor system delays can cascade into significant operational issues. For example, delayed warehouse scanning, misrouted shipments, or incorrect inventory updates can disrupt supply chains and erode customer trust. By implementing a structured system performance monitoring program, companies can maintain high reliability, identify recurring issues, and optimize resource allocation.

Beyond detection, performance analytics provide insights into capacity planning, workload distribution, and technology utilization. Companies gain visibility into which systems support critical processes most effectively, enabling targeted upgrades and strategic planning. This approach also supports cost efficiency, as underperforming or redundant systems can be optimized or replaced.

Integrating system performance monitoring with data quality management further strengthens operational resilience. Accurate data enhances decision-making, improves predictive logistics, and ensures compliance with contractual and regulatory obligations. Together, performance and data quality initiatives help logistics companies achieve measurable operational improvements, reduce risk, and increase customer satisfaction.

Organizations that prioritize system performance are better equipped to scale, adopt emerging technologies, and navigate complex supply chains. By transforming reactive maintenance into proactive management, logistics providers enhance operational predictability, reliability, and competitiveness in an increasingly digital marketplace.
